  • Snow should fall in abundance on Tuesday over the whole of Brittany.

  • Forecasters expect three to five centimeters, even ten centimeters locally.

  • The prefecture of the West Defense Zone could take measures on Monday to limit the movement of heavy goods vehicles.

While a cold snap is announced for Tuesday across the whole of France, the Breton peninsula could be the first to wear a white coat.

“We are expecting a mass of cold air from Siberia which will encounter a disturbance which will rise from the Bay of Biscay with milder air and precipitation.

On the Atlantic coast, it could be rain but inland, there will be snow, that's for sure, ”says Steven Tual, forecaster at Météo Bretagne.

Expected during the day, this snowfall could even be substantial, according to the regional weather site.

“The episode will be quite notable and it should be generalized.

We expect 2 to 5 centimeters, even 10 centimeters locally, ”continues the forecaster.

The question everyone is asking is where is this snow going to fall.

A priori everywhere.

The north of the Rennes basin, the sectors of Combourg, Fougères and the usual Kreiz Breizh (central Brittany) should be the best served, although this remains to be confirmed.

Negative temperatures expected

According to Météo Bretagne, we have to go back to 2013 to find traces of such a marked episode.

The arrival of a very cold phenomenon could also allow the snow to hold on to the ground, perhaps even for several days, which is rare in the region.

"We can expect a phenomenon of nocturnal radiation where snow-covered ground contributes to a drop in temperatures," warns the forecaster.

The white of the snow "reflects" more heat than the dark masses.

Temperatures that can drop to -10 degrees could thus be recorded.

If Brittany will be the first to benefit from it, the flakes should also fall in abundance in the bordering departments.

"This will have to be confirmed on Monday but we are expecting 3 to 5 centimeters in Mayenne, or even 7 to 8 centimeters locally," explains Patrick Casteiltort, forecaster at Météo-France.

The neighboring Loire-Atlantique will be suspended from the thermometer to know its fate.

A mixture of rain and snow is expected Tuesday afternoon, which could cause an episode of ice.

The coming phenomenon is taken very seriously by the authorities.

Météo-France has thus decided to launch an early warning on Sunday, which will have to be confirmed on Monday.

Contacted, the prefecture of the Western defense zone explains "wait to know the extent and location of snowfall" before making decisions.

If the risk of snow-covered roads is confirmed, detours could be put in place for heavy goods vehicles with a strong incentive to postpone trips.
